Simon I am sitting here looking at the instruction sheet that I got with my Probe forged aluminum racing pistons and it is very clear about the piston to wall clearance.

N/A street cars 0.004"
Blown/Turbo/Nitrous 0.005"
Drag/Circle Track/Road Race 0.0055".

My clearance was machined to 0.005" and I have had no issues in 2600 miles of road and some track use. They also note that engines that are honed without torque plates will require additional 0.001" clearance. Also the piston diameter should be measured at the bottom of the skirt.
